I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Fortran Discussion :

[Fortran 90] Calcul parallèle


Sujet :

Fortran

  1. #1
    Nouveau Candidat au Club
    Profil pro
    Inscrit en
    Novembre 2008
    Messages
    1
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Novembre 2008
    Messages : 1
    Points : 1
    Points
    1
    Par défaut [Fortran 90] Calcul parallèle
    Je dois coder en Fortran 90 une décomposition de domaine pour équation chaleur 2D évolution avec la méthode de Schwartz additif. Je débute en programmation parallèle. Je suis sur MPI.

    Merci

  2. #2
    Membre éclairé Avatar de genteur slayer
    Homme Profil pro
    Développeur informatique
    Inscrit en
    Juin 2002
    Messages
    710
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Rhône (Rhône Alpes)

    Informations professionnelles :
    Activité : Développeur informatique
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Juin 2002
    Messages : 710
    Points : 825
    Points
    825
    Par défaut
    déjà, le premier truc c'est de bien installe MPI
    ensuite il faut lancer le prog qui gère le protocol de transfert
    enfin, bien compiler avec les options MPI...

    ensuite dans ton code, pour décomposer en sous-domaine l'idée c'est de faire des mailles qui se chevauche, pour avoir leur valeurs, c'est simple il suffit d'appeler MPI à) la rescousse pour qu'il aille chercher la valeur dans l'autre process... (c super simpliste ce que je dis)

    pour plus de renseignement (et la solution à ton problème d'ailleur car c un TP classique) va sur cette page:
    http://www.idris.fr/data/cours/paral...choix_doc.html

    c'est bien expliqué, en français et tout... que demande le peuple!!!

    cela dit, je déconne mais c'est pas évident la parallélisation, bon courrage!
    il n'y a que ceux qui savent qui ne savent pas qu'ils savent...
    Libere-toi hacker, GNU's Not Unix!!!

  3. #3
    Rédacteur

    Homme Profil pro
    Comme retraité, des masses
    Inscrit en
    Avril 2007
    Messages
    2 978
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 83
    Localisation : Suisse

    Informations professionnelles :
    Activité : Comme retraité, des masses
    Secteur : Industrie

    Informations forums :
    Inscription : Avril 2007
    Messages : 2 978
    Points : 5 179
    Points
    5 179
    Par défaut
    Salut!
    equation chaleur 2D evolution avec la methode de Schwartz additif
    Pourquoi cette méthode plutôt que des différences finies ou des éléments finis, ce qui te dispenserait de te casser la tête avec de la programmation parallèle.
    A la fin des années 60, j'ai fait un programme qui tournait très bien en n'utilisant qu'environ 100 kilobytes pour un réseau comportant 3000 noeuds. Alors, imagine ce qu'on peut faire maintenant!
    Jean-Marc Blanc
    Calcul numérique de processus industriels
    Formation, conseil, développement

    Point n'est besoin d'espérer pour entreprendre, ni de réussir pour persévérer. (Guillaume le Taiseux)

  4. #4
    Débutant
    Inscrit en
    Juillet 2007
    Messages
    386
    Détails du profil
    Informations forums :
    Inscription : Juillet 2007
    Messages : 386
    Points : 119
    Points
    119
    Par défaut
    tout depend de ce que tu cherche exactement..
    si tu cherche seulement lasolution, Jean Marc a totalement raison, il suffit d utiliser une methode d elements finis par exempe, et sa programation est hyper facile sur des logiciels bien specifique (par exemple freefem)

Discussions similaires

  1. MPI calcul parallèle
    Par Darktrouble dans le forum Bibliothèques
    Réponses: 1
    Dernier message: 17/04/2008, 14h47
  2. Calcul parallèles et multi taches !
    Par Darktrouble dans le forum Débuter
    Réponses: 1
    Dernier message: 03/03/2008, 15h29
  3. calcul parallèle et thread
    Par deb75 dans le forum Algorithmes et structures de données
    Réponses: 9
    Dernier message: 13/06/2007, 23h35
  4. livre gestion de la mémoire + calcul parallèle
    Par salseropom dans le forum C
    Réponses: 6
    Dernier message: 08/01/2007, 17h16
  5. calcul parallèle (débutant)
    Par Mrj dans le forum MFC
    Réponses: 1
    Dernier message: 08/12/2005, 12h06

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o